Output d7c42bc0fe254cbfb2cbfc14f4df86caa4bf7cebe928b01383cea6b22d57dbcc:0

value
519760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a3bce190f4f97c1c8eb9105f154378f17b20b08 OP_EQUAL
address
3EHvpLzN4ikLbC6eYDrZrH6UkkRauP8Xug
transaction
d7c42bc0fe254cbfb2cbfc14f4df86caa4bf7cebe928b01383cea6b22d57dbcc
confirmations
390734
spent
true